Reprinting (1961) of first (1956) edition. Volume II (2) only. Generously illustrated with photographs, maps and diagrams. Octavo/quarto borderline in size (25 cm high). These were written as comprehensive histories offering an inter-service view of the course of the conflict. Editors Major-General I.S.O. Playfair and C.J.C. Molony, with other co-editors. Series editor (of the United Kingdom Military Series) J.R.M. Butler. Contents of Vol II: The Germans Come to the Help of Their Ally, 424 pp. Ex public library.
